- The distance between Perpignan, France and Darlington, Sc, Usa is approximately 6,960 km or 4,325 mi.
- To reach Perpignan in this distance one would set out from Darlington, Sc bearing 55.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Perpignan bearing 112.9° or ESE .
- Perpignan has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Darlington, Sc has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Perpignan is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Darlington, Sc is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 1.8 °C (3.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.1 °C (7.4°F) less in Perpignan.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 622.1 mm (24.5 in) less which is equivalent to 622.1 l/m² (15.27 US gal/ft²) or 6,221,000 l/ha (665,066 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.2° lower in Perpignan than in Darlington, Sc.
